Preview: Phillies at Mets Aug. 22, 2009

phillies logoPhiladelphia Phillies (69-50 Road: 37-21) at New York Mets (57-65 Home: 34-29) 7:10pm

J.A. Happ (9-2 2.66) vs. Tim Redding (1-4 6.53)

TV: SNY

What to watch: Redding is making his first start back in the rotation since the Mets released Livan Hernandez. Redding was the obvious choice for the rotation because he’s been rocked in his last two relief outings, giving up 6 earned runs over 4 innings. On the other hand, Happ has been outstanding this year. He hasn’t allowed more than 2 runs in his last four starts including a complete game shutout of the Rockies on Aug. 5.

Preview: Braves at Mets Aug. 18, 2009

braves logoAtlanta Braves (62-56 Road: 30-29) at New York Mets (55-63 Home: 32-27) 7:10pm

Derek Lowe (12-7 4.08) vs. Oliver Perez (2-3 5.97)

TV: SNY

What to watch: The Braves come to town hot, winning seven of their last nine games. Lowe has won his last five decisions and hasn’t lost a game since July 5. You already know about the Mets struggles but Perez has pitched well lately only allowing 2 earned runs over 11.2 innings in his last two starts. This will be Ryan Church‘s first game back at Citi Field since being traded to the Braves. I expect him to get a good welcome back from the crowd and everyone on the team, except for maybe Jerry Manuel.

Preview: Giants at Mets Aug. 15, 2009

giants logoSan Francisco Giants (62-53 Road: 23-33) at New York Mets (54-61 Home: 31-25) 4:10pm

Matt Cain (12-4 2.44) vs. Johan Santana (13-8 3.00)

TV: FOX

What to watch: Cain’s been having an unbelievable season but his last two starts have been sub-par. The Giants lost both games and he gave up 9 runs in 15 innings. Santana’s last start against the Padres was fantastic going 8 innings and only giving up 1 run. This is a terrific pitching matchup for those lucky enough to be going to the game. Expect Billy Wagner to start making his way to New York today with the intent of rejoining the team as early as tomorrow.
